meet the SEEDlingsAt every SEED meeting, we begin with a Question of the Day. This tends to be as varied as our members, with questions like What is your favorite sign of spring? and How is the elephant feeling? We asked our 2009-2010 executive board this zinger: What do you think is the best view? Here's what they had to say. *Denotes leadership opportunity available Co-Chairs

join our team. SEED is always looking for new leaders. Whether it's organizing a group to paint the rock or becoming a member of our executive board, every person who takes on any amount of responsibility is vitally important to SEED's survival and the accomplishment of environmental goals at Northwestern. If you would like to join our group of leaders, we encourage you to come to our meetings to learn more about the opportunities available.

 

executive board Executive Board meetings are held every Sunday evening in Norris from 8:00 - 9:30 PM.
